Transaction 169fbb068a0bc80a6a02b4f6c76137e1e7c50aaede701f99550165066c869af3

1 Input
1 Outputs
  • 169fbb068a0bc80a6a02b4f6c76137e1e7c50aaede701f99550165066c869af3:0
  • value  405167070
    address  172AG5UsC7LdbKy46UeHdaAsvGaFwH3dkG